1. Stay Calm and Assess the Situation:
The first thing to do when your HVAC system breaks down is to stay calm and assess the situation. Check if the system is completely non-functional or if it is just not heating or cooling properly. Look for any obvious signs of damage or malfunction, such as strange noises, leaks, or unusual odors. This initial assessment will help you provide valuable information to the emergency HVAC service technicians when you call for help.
2. Turn Off the System:
If you notice any signs of damage or malfunction, it is important to turn off the HVAC system immediately to prevent further damage and ensure safety. This can help avoid potential hazards such as electrical fires or gas leaks. Make sure to switch off the power at the circuit breaker or disconnect the system from the power source.

4. Follow Safety Precautions:
While waiting for the emergency HVAC technicians to arrive, it is important to follow safety precautions to protect yourself and your property. Keep children and pets away from the HVAC system, especially if there are exposed wires or other potential hazards. If you smell gas or suspect a gas leak, evacuate the premises immediately and call the fire department.
